5. Anticipating Potential Challenges:

Completion time is also a factor that can make a difference between a successful investment and one that has gone bad in the off-plan property purchase process. The possibilities for construction delays are wide ranging and can be caused by a whole lot of reasons, such as the direct effects of global events, economic crises in the countries, or logistical problems.

Considering the risks associated with off-plan properties, investors should be well acquainted with the regulations in place, like those established by the Real Estate Regulation Agency (RERA) in Dubai. When familiar with the rights and protection mechanisms provided, buyers and investors will be able to handle challenges more efficiently.

6. Navigating Resale Restrictions:

Before the property comes into use, there are some complications arising from the developers’ built in restrictions. More than one developer needs buyers to reach certain payment milestones before he/she is allowed for resale, thereby making it convoluted. Before buying a condo, enter into negotiations on the resale terms that the developer offers. This proactive approach to envisaging these restraints ahead of the resale of the properties will help the investors avoid the unpleasant experience when they might want to sell their off-plan properties.

8. Regulatory Environment:

Be acquainted with the laws that are set-up for off-plan property investments in Dubai. This includes properly carrying out RERA stipulations, escrow account arrangements, investor protection measures, and legal documents. Meeting regulatory requirements is one of the top priorities on the list of every safety-oriented and transparent investment process.

Essential Tips for Navigating the Process:

To navigate the off-plan property investment process effectively, investors should consider the following tips:

  • Verify Project Legitimacy: First, invest only in those projects authorized by RERA including the verification of the project’s legitimacy.
  • Understand Price Structures: Assess payment options and all the hidden charges so that your student will be financially prepared and not surprised to encounter unexpected costs.
  • Location Matters: Identify projects in main locations with robust growth projections and more attractive ROI opportunities.
  • Thorough Contract Review: Read contracts thoroughly and when the clauses are not favorable to you, renegotiate with the developers to protect your rights
